Other tax credits: entitlement

11.—(1) The supplier in each of the following cases is entitled to a tax credit in respect of any relevant amount of CCL charged on the supply in question (subject to the provisions of this Part including those provisions relating to the making of a relevant claim to the Commissioners)—

(a)after a taxable supply has been made, there is such a change in circumstances or any person’s intentions that, if the changed circumstances or intentions had existed at the time of supply, the supply would not have been a taxable supply;

(b)after a supply of a taxable commodity is made on the basis that it is a taxable supply, it is determined that the supply was not (to any extent) a taxable supply;

(c)after a taxable supply has been made on the basis that it was neither a half-rate supply nor a reduced-rate supply, it is determined that the supply was (to any extent) a half-rate or reduced-rate supply;

(d)CCL is accounted for on a half-rate supply as if the supply were neither a half-rate supply nor a reduced-rate supply;

(e)after a charge to CCL has arisen on a supply of a taxable commodity (“the original commodity”) to a person who uses the commodity supplied in producing taxable commodities primarily for his own consumption, that person makes supplies of any of the commodities in whose production he has used the original commodity;

(f)the making of a taxable supply gives rise to a double charge to CCL within the meaning of paragraph 21 of the Act.

(2) In paragraph (1), “relevant amount of CCL” refers to—

(a)in relation to a case described by sub-paragraph (a), (b), (c), (d) or (e) of paragraph (1), the difference between the amount of CCL that ought to have been charged by or under the Act at the time of supply and the amount of CCL that was actually accounted for and paid by the supplier; and

(b)in relation to a case described by sub-paragraph (f) of paragraph (1), the amount of CCL actually charged and paid on the later supply having regard to the relative times of supply.
